MAINE, USA — Hannaford Supermarkets is pulling several varieties of its store-brand frozen waffles from shelves due to listeria concerns.
In a news release from the grocery store chain, Hannaford Supermarkets says it was alerted by supplier TreeHouse Foods that multiple frozen waffle products "have the potential to be contaminated with Listeria."
There have been no confirmed reports of illnesses or injuries linked to the recalled products, according to TreeHouse Foods.

Customers are urged to check their freezers for the frozen waffle products and to not consume them, the release stated. The recalled products can be returned to local Hannaford locations for a full refund.

According to the Maine Center for Disease Control and Prevention, listeriosis is an infection caused by eating food contaminated with the listeria bacteria such as raw foods like uncooked meats and vegetables, or processed foods like soft cheeses or unpasteurized milk.
Fever, fatigue, body aches, diarrhea, and vomiting are common symptoms associated with listeriosis, and the illness typically affects pregnant women, newborns, and adults with compromised immune systems.
